RUSSELL, Kan. - Alta Faye Blanke, 61, died Saturday, June 17 at Via Christi St. Francis Hospital in Wichita, Kan.
Services will be held at 2:30 p.m. Tuesday at Pohlman's Memorial Chapel in Russell, Kan with Rev. James Alexander. Burial will be in Russell City Cemetery.
Mrs. Blanke was born on June 29, 1938, in Athens, Ark. She lived her early life in Arkansas and Texas. She married Kenneth Blanke on March 17, 1967, in Borger. They moved to Great Bend, Kan. and then to Russell, Kan. in 1968. She was a homemaker and a member of Calvary Chapel Assembly of God Church in Russell, Kan.
Survivors include her husband, Kenneth Blanke; three sons, Jerry Mayberry of Borger, Ricky Mayberry of Russell, Kan. and Ronny Mayberry of Natoma, Kan.; one daughter, Lynn Smith of Hoisington, Kan.; two step-sons, Eugene Blanke of Claremore, Okla., David Blanke of Florissant, Mo.; two step-daughters, Heidi Blanke of St. Louis, Mo., and Star Blanke of Wichita, Kan.; 17 grandchildren and four great-grandchildren.
Memorials may be made to Calvary Chapel Assembly of God Church or Shrine Hospitals in care of the mortuary.
